The queenfish (Seriphus politus) is a species of fish in the family Sciaenidae, the drums and croakers. It is native to the eastern Pacific Ocean , where it occurs along the North American coastline from Oregon to Baja California ; it has been recorded as far north as British Columbia .

The doublespotted queenfish (Scomberoides lysan) is a tropical game fish in family Carangidae (jacks). It is associated with reefs and ranges widely throughout the Indian and Pacific Oceans . Scomberoides tol is a coastal fish which can be found in estuaries and inshore waters, [3] often forming small schools of adults near the surface. [2] The adults are predators of other fishes while the juveniles have specialised rasping teeth and feed off the scales and skin of other fish. [1]
